WiseTech, REA and CAR Look Best Insulated From AI Threat -- Market Talk

Dow Jones
01/07

2253 GMT - WiseTech Global, REA and CAR Group are seen by Jefferies analyst Roger Samuel as the Australian tech and media stocks best insulated from the threat of AI-driven competition. Samuel reckons that software developer WiseTech is protected by factors including the complexity of the logistics industry in which it operates. He writes in a note that News Corp-controlled property advertiser REA has a robust data moat, strong brand, and high loyalty from realtors. He thinks that any AI-driven vehicle advertiser seeking to challenge CAR would need to provide a superior user experience. However, he points out this is an area in which the incumbent consistently innovates. News Corp is the parent company of Dow Jones & Co., publisher of The Wall Street Journal and Dow Jones Newswires.
